As soon as Mr. Wu finished speaking, Princess Ata could no longer contain herself. She stepped out from behind the Emperor and the others, pointed at Mr. Wu, and angrily denounced him.

"So this has been your true goal all along—to incite war between the Central Plains and Nanjiang! You don’t want everyone to practice Witchcraft; you want to turn them all into Witch Power-assimilated individuals. Then you can control them and make them serve your ends!" 𝚏𝗿𝗲𝐞𝐰𝚎𝕓𝐧𝚘𝘃𝗲𝐥.𝐜𝚘𝕞

Mr. Wu let out a strange chuckle at Princess Ata’s accusation. "Ha! Princess Ata, you certainly have a vivid imagination. You’re not wrong, but you’ve only guessed half of it!"

"Only half? What do you mean by that?"

Princess Ata felt a surge of panic. If this was only half the truth, then what was the other half?

"Princess Ata, you are, in fact, a perfect practitioner of Witchcraft. It’s merely a pity that seven years ago, your Witch Power was destroyed by Ji Youyuan. As a result, you can no longer receive Witch Power infusions and can only rebuild your cultivation slowly, bit by bit!"

Hearing this, Princess Ata clenched her jaw. Memories of seven years past involuntarily flooded her mind, her composure instantly shattering.

Feeling Princess Ata’s body tremble, Xie Pan’Er quickly steadied her. "What’s wrong?"

"I... I want to kill this traitorous villain!"

Princess Ata gritted her teeth. Her mind raced back seven years, to when the Great Wizard of Nanjiang had announced to the world that he had found his successor. Although he never revealed this successor’s identity or name, he widely proclaimed her extraordinary and unparalleled talent—how brilliant her innate gifts were, how accomplished her cultivation! Indeed, Princess Ata was exceptionally gifted and intelligent. Her cultivation progressed swiftly, and the Great Wizard always said she was a talent with great promise. So, he directly performed a Witch Power Infusion on her, granting her fifty years of Power. For a time, her prominence in the Nanjiang royal court was unmatched. But later, she gradually discovered that her body was often not under her own control. Sometimes she would lose consciousness for no reason. Gradually, she found herself killing indiscriminately, committing all sorts of heinous acts. Until one day, she met a man from the Central Plains. He was young yet already possessed profound cultivation, having become a Half-Step Grandmaster before the age of thirty. His appearance offered her a sliver of opportunity. She deliberately engaged him in a prolonged magical duel, eventually forcing him to use the Mind-Probing Dream Scroll. She seized the chance, using the scroll to cleanse her mind and spirit. When she emerged, she had destroyed her own Witch Power and fallen into a deep coma. When she awoke, more than three months had passed, and she never saw that man again. It wasn’t until later, when she arrived in Great Han, that she saw the Dream Scroll again before the Mingwu Building. Only then did she realize that the man with whom she had fiercely battled in Nanjiang back then was actually the Sect Leader of the Illusion Sect, and moreover, the eldest son of Ji Shang, Great Han’s God of War! However, when he saw her, he didn’t utter a single word about what had happened back then! So she felt there was no need for her to bring it up either!

As these memories, so vivid they felt present, replayed in Princess Ata’s mind, waves of hatred surged within her heart. She knew perfectly well that this Mr. Wu before her, like the previous one, was surely just a puppet. Yet, fueled by rage, she gathered her Witch Power, channeled her Qi, and lunged forward, fiercely striking out with her palm at Mr. Wu!

"Hmph! Overestimating your abilities!" Mr. Wu snorted coldly, retaliating instantly with a powerful palm strike of his own, sending her flying backward!

"AAAH!" Princess Ata cried out, spewing blood as she hurtled through the air.

"Princess Ata!" Xie Pan’Er cried out worriedly, rushing forward to catch her. "Are you all right?"

"COUGH, COUGH!" Princess Ata coughed up a mouthful of blood, her body weak as she leaned against Xie Pan’Er’s shoulder.

"It truly is a pity. Your Witch Power was completely dispersed, and you had to start your cultivation anew. Yet, in just a few short years, you’ve managed to reach this level. If Ji Youyuan hadn’t destroyed your cultivation back then, you would undoubtedly be an exceptionally perfect vessel by now!"

Mr. Wu’s voice carried a tone of both lament and frustration.

Princess Ata, however, found his words nauseating and infuriating. Although her body was injured, it didn’t mean she was truly so vulnerable!

"Vessel? In your dreams!" Princess Ata retorted. With a flick of her wrist, a short flute appeared in her hand, and she began to play a plaintive, wailing tune.

Xie Pan’Er and the others recognized the melody; it was the tune Princess Ata used to summon birds and beasts.
